Special buses for Chithra Pournami festival

The Salem division of the Tamil Nadu State Transport Corporation Limited will operate special buses round the clock from different parts of the western districts of Salem, Krishnagiri, Dharmapuri and Namakkal from May 2 to May 4 in connection with the Chithra Pournami festival on May 3.

The TNSTC will operate the special buses from Salem to Tiruvannamalai (via Harur and Uthangarai); Dharmapuri to Tiruvannamalai (via Uthangarai); Krishnagiri to Tiruvannamalai (via Uthangarai); Hosur to Tiruvannamalai (via Uthangarai); Attur to Tiruvannamalai (via Kallakurichi); Dharmapuri to Palani; Krishnagiri to Palani; Hosur to Palani; Salem to Palani; Salem to Melmaruvathur; Salem to Madheswaran Hills in Karnataka State (via Mecheri and Mettur) and Mettur to Madheswaran Hills (via Kolathur and Palar).

The TNSTC will operate about 200 special buses, an official release issued here on Thursday said and called upon people to take advantage of the same for a safe and comfortable travel.
